Champion
The Champion skill Swift Blade is now affected by blade line modifiers instead of strike line modifiers.
Champions with Glorious Exchange active can no longer activate Exchange of Blows.
Minstrel
Melody of Battle, when used on others will now correctly add the full value of damage reflection and bonus parry rating.
The Westernesse Lute no longer adds to the Healing Power Cost requirements.
The Tier 7 flutes added with Isengard now correctly require Flute use.
Anthem of War will now provide a standard 5% boost to fellowship members affected by the minstrel buff.
The Minstrel self bubble from Story/Song of the Hammerhand has been reduced by a fair amount. It is still pretty darn good though.
Crafting
The majority of the crafting recipes that were removed from the Crafting vendors have been brought back, with the exception of Tier 6. Tier 6 recipes can be found in treasure drops.

Virtues have been extended to Rank 14.
Stat Tomes from Sturdy Steel Lockboxes: fix for old version that would allow you to use the same tier more than once (to no effect). New drops will only have tomes that are unusable if you have already used the same one in the past.
Stat Tomes and Relic Removal Scrolls: all tiers of stat tomes and the relic removal scroll can now drop from the final bosses in scaled instances.
All items that are restricted to a character class or a small selection of character classes have been removed from the lockboxes.
Melding recipes for the store exclusive relics can now be found in game on the Relic Forging Master.
Marks, Medallions, Seals, and Relic Currency are all now bind to account.
Worn Symbols of Celebrimbor are now available via Skirmish barter vendors.
